Institution / College: University of Cape Town

UCT

University of Cape Town, a public institution in Rondebosch, focuses on diverse fields including humanities, science, and engineering. Key academic programs include Bachelor's and Master's degrees in Medicine, Law, Engineering, and African Studies. International collaborations facilitate student exchange programs with institutions globally. The library provides extensive academic resources, including digital databases and special collections supporting faculty and student research.
